Lines Matching refs:phys_addr
65 unsigned long end, phys_addr_t phys_addr, pgprot_t prot, in ioremap_pte_range() argument
71 pfn = phys_addr >> PAGE_SHIFT; in ioremap_pte_range()
85 unsigned long end, phys_addr_t phys_addr, in ioremap_try_huge_pmd() argument
97 if (!IS_ALIGNED(phys_addr, PMD_SIZE)) in ioremap_try_huge_pmd()
103 return pmd_set_huge(pmd, phys_addr, prot); in ioremap_try_huge_pmd()
107 unsigned long end, phys_addr_t phys_addr, pgprot_t prot, in ioremap_pmd_range() argument
119 if (ioremap_try_huge_pmd(pmd, addr, next, phys_addr, prot)) { in ioremap_pmd_range()
124 if (ioremap_pte_range(pmd, addr, next, phys_addr, prot, mask)) in ioremap_pmd_range()
126 } while (pmd++, phys_addr += (next - addr), addr = next, addr != end); in ioremap_pmd_range()
131 unsigned long end, phys_addr_t phys_addr, in ioremap_try_huge_pud() argument
143 if (!IS_ALIGNED(phys_addr, PUD_SIZE)) in ioremap_try_huge_pud()
149 return pud_set_huge(pud, phys_addr, prot); in ioremap_try_huge_pud()
153 unsigned long end, phys_addr_t phys_addr, pgprot_t prot, in ioremap_pud_range() argument
165 if (ioremap_try_huge_pud(pud, addr, next, phys_addr, prot)) { in ioremap_pud_range()
170 if (ioremap_pmd_range(pud, addr, next, phys_addr, prot, mask)) in ioremap_pud_range()
172 } while (pud++, phys_addr += (next - addr), addr = next, addr != end); in ioremap_pud_range()
177 unsigned long end, phys_addr_t phys_addr, in ioremap_try_huge_p4d() argument
189 if (!IS_ALIGNED(phys_addr, P4D_SIZE)) in ioremap_try_huge_p4d()
195 return p4d_set_huge(p4d, phys_addr, prot); in ioremap_try_huge_p4d()
199 unsigned long end, phys_addr_t phys_addr, pgprot_t prot, in ioremap_p4d_range() argument
211 if (ioremap_try_huge_p4d(p4d, addr, next, phys_addr, prot)) { in ioremap_p4d_range()
216 if (ioremap_pud_range(p4d, addr, next, phys_addr, prot, mask)) in ioremap_p4d_range()
218 } while (p4d++, phys_addr += (next - addr), addr = next, addr != end); in ioremap_p4d_range()
223 unsigned long end, phys_addr_t phys_addr, pgprot_t prot) in ioremap_page_range() argument
238 err = ioremap_p4d_range(pgd, addr, next, phys_addr, prot, in ioremap_page_range()
242 } while (pgd++, phys_addr += (next - addr), addr = next, addr != end); in ioremap_page_range()